Android 3.0 Honeycomb 预览SDK 发布,安卓巴士为您解析android3.0新功能

本文主要是介绍Android 3.0 Honeycomb 预览SDK 发布,安卓巴士为您解析android3.0新功能,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

   1.jpg

 


         1月28日消息,据国外媒体报道,谷歌本周三发布了Android 3.0的软件开发工具包(SDK)预览版,以便开发者测试几周内即将发布的SDK正式版。下面 安卓巴士为您解析Android3.0的界面的新细节

  为平板设计的新界面:

   安卓巴士发现在Android 3.0 Honeycomb专为大屏幕平板重新设计了用户界面,称为holographic(全息),主要关注互动性。 Android 3.0重新定义了多任务、丰富的提醒栏、可自定义的主界面、widgets等等(如上图)。

  系统栏,也就是通知栏,可在任意程序里快速访问提醒和系统信息,还有软件导航的虚拟按钮,它们位于整个界面最下方,在看视频的时候它们也会淡出隐藏不显示

  动作栏,用于对应用进行控制,显示在屏幕最上方,可查看应用的菜单、导航、widget,在你打开应用之后就一直显示(相当于Android里按menu后弹出的菜单)

  可自定义的主界面,可放置widget,应用快捷方式和壁纸,通过打开launcher可看到所有应用图标的列表,当然还有全局搜索框

  最近打开的应用列表,可轻松看到多任务图标。在系统栏里就可以进入最近打开的应用列表,它会直接显示应用的截图,而非像iOS那样只显示个图标(如下图)

2.jpg


 



  重新设计的键盘:

  方便更快更精确的输入文字,键盘的大小和位置都重新设计了,还加入了一些新案件,比如Tab键,可以提供更高效的文字输入。用户可以按住某个键进入特殊文字菜单,或者切换为语音输入模式,见下图。

4.jpg


 



  改进的文字选择和复制/粘帖:

  这个Android 2.3 Gingerboard就有了,可以通过两个“游标卡尺”来选择选中哪些文字,进行复制/粘帖和剪切操作。

  新的外设支持:

   安卓巴士发现Android 3.0开始原生支持文件/图片传输协议,让用户可通过USB接口连接相机或电脑来同步数据,也可通过USB或蓝牙连接实体键盘进行更快速的文字输入。同时改进了WiFi连接,搜索信号速度更快。可通过蓝牙来进行tether连接,分享Android平板的3G信号给其它设备。

  内置应用更新:

5.jpg


 



  浏览器(上图):提供导航条,方便用户导航和组织页面。可直接显示出多标签页,方便切换。增加匿名模式,方便看见不得人的网页。在登录自己的Google帐户之后,可与桌面版的Chrome浏览器同步书签。多点触摸开始支持Javascript和插件。

  摄像头和图片库(下图):摄像头应用重新设计,可直接在屏幕上操作曝光、对焦、闪光灯、变焦和前置摄像头。图片库应用则可以让用户全屏浏览照片。

  联系人:联系人应用变成了两栏结构,可快速滚动,改进了对格式和国际化手机号的支持,地址写的是哪里就按哪里的形式显示。联系人以卡片的形式显示,方便阅读和编辑。

  邮件:也是两栏结构,方便浏览和组织邮件,可选择多个邮件操作,改变文件夹等等。有一个桌面用的邮件widget。

6.jpg


 



8.jpg


 



7.jpg


 



    Android 3.0 Honeycomb针对开发者的新功能:

9.jpg


 




        安卓巴士总结了Android 3.0 Honeycomb总共新加或者加强了以下的十四项新功能。

  一、新UI框架,方便创建平板应用

  二、重新设计的

  三、可扩展的桌面widget(上图)

  四、一直显示在屏幕上的动作栏

  五、更丰富的提示栏,可显示富媒体信息,可控制大小图标

  六、支持多选,剪切板和拖拽的互动模式

  七、新的动画框架

  八、支持硬件2D加速

  九、可渲染脚本的3D界面引擎

  十、支持多核心结构

  十一、支持HTTP Live流,通过M3U播放列表URL来进行HTTP实时直播

  十二、内置DRM框架

  十三、可对数字媒体文件进行存取操作

  十四、对企业良好的支持,对老应用也可进行支持,不用改代码也可在平板上跑

这篇关于Android 3.0 Honeycomb 预览SDK 发布,安卓巴士为您解析android3.0新功能的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/380767

相关文章

Android 12解决push framework.jar无法开机的方法小结

《Android12解决pushframework.jar无法开机的方法小结》:本文主要介绍在Android12中解决pushframework.jar无法开机的方法,包括编译指令、框架层和s... 目录1. android 编译指令1.1 framework层的编译指令1.2 替换framework.ja

使用Python创建一个功能完整的Windows风格计算器程序

《使用Python创建一个功能完整的Windows风格计算器程序》:本文主要介绍如何使用Python和Tkinter创建一个功能完整的Windows风格计算器程序,包括基本运算、高级科学计算(如三... 目录python实现Windows系统计算器程序(含高级功能)1. 使用Tkinter实现基础计算器2.

Android开发环境配置避坑指南

《Android开发环境配置避坑指南》本文主要介绍了Android开发环境配置过程中遇到的问题及解决方案,包括VPN注意事项、工具版本统一、Gerrit邮箱配置、Git拉取和提交代码、MergevsR... 目录网络环境:VPN 注意事项工具版本统一:android Studio & JDKGerrit的邮

Android实现定时任务的几种方式汇总(附源码)

《Android实现定时任务的几种方式汇总(附源码)》在Android应用中,定时任务(ScheduledTask)的需求几乎无处不在:从定时刷新数据、定时备份、定时推送通知,到夜间静默下载、循环执行... 目录一、项目介绍1. 背景与意义二、相关基础知识与系统约束三、方案一:Handler.postDel

Qt实现网络数据解析的方法总结

《Qt实现网络数据解析的方法总结》在Qt中解析网络数据通常涉及接收原始字节流,并将其转换为有意义的应用层数据,这篇文章为大家介绍了详细步骤和示例,感兴趣的小伙伴可以了解下... 目录1. 网络数据接收2. 缓冲区管理(处理粘包/拆包)3. 常见数据格式解析3.1 jsON解析3.2 XML解析3.3 自定义

Android使用ImageView.ScaleType实现图片的缩放与裁剪功能

《Android使用ImageView.ScaleType实现图片的缩放与裁剪功能》ImageView是最常用的控件之一,它用于展示各种类型的图片,为了能够根据需求调整图片的显示效果,Android提... 目录什么是 ImageView.ScaleType?FIT_XYFIT_STARTFIT_CENTE

Golang HashMap实现原理解析

《GolangHashMap实现原理解析》HashMap是一种基于哈希表实现的键值对存储结构,它通过哈希函数将键映射到数组的索引位置,支持高效的插入、查找和删除操作,:本文主要介绍GolangH... 目录HashMap是一种基于哈希表实现的键值对存储结构,它通过哈希函数将键映射到数组的索引位置,支持

Python的time模块一些常用功能(各种与时间相关的函数)

《Python的time模块一些常用功能(各种与时间相关的函数)》Python的time模块提供了各种与时间相关的函数,包括获取当前时间、处理时间间隔、执行时间测量等,:本文主要介绍Python的... 目录1. 获取当前时间2. 时间格式化3. 延时执行4. 时间戳运算5. 计算代码执行时间6. 转换为指

Python使用getopt处理命令行参数示例解析(最佳实践)

《Python使用getopt处理命令行参数示例解析(最佳实践)》getopt模块是Python标准库中一个简单但强大的命令行参数处理工具,它特别适合那些需要快速实现基本命令行参数解析的场景,或者需要... 目录为什么需要处理命令行参数?getopt模块基础实际应用示例与其他参数处理方式的比较常见问http

Python利用ElementTree实现快速解析XML文件

《Python利用ElementTree实现快速解析XML文件》ElementTree是Python标准库的一部分,而且是Python标准库中用于解析和操作XML数据的模块,下面小编就来和大家详细讲讲... 目录一、XML文件解析到底有多重要二、ElementTree快速入门1. 加载XML的两种方式2.